Well, here's what it says at the DJI website's Phantom 2 wiki:

"System Requirement of Mobile Device: iOS version 6.0 or above/ Android system version 4.0 or above
Mobile Device Support: Recommended: iPhone4s, iPhone5, iPhone5s, iPod Touch4, iPod Touch5; available but not recommended: iPAD3, iPAD4, iPAD mini. Samsung Galaxy S3, S4, Note2, Note3 or phones of similar configuration."
